Albury Council this month accepted the tender from Centrum Architects for the amount of $234,825.25 for what is shaping as the biggest sporting facility upgrade in the city after the Lavington Sportsground redevelopment which is due for completion in August.
Six companies bid for the detailed design works contract with only one border-based firm bidding, JWP Architects in Wodonga.
The Shepparton Sports and Events Centre redevelopment was a similar project to Lauren Jackson Sports Centre performed by Centrum Architects.
Creating a showcourt with a seating capacity of up to 1400 people with retractable seating to protect the playing surfaces and allow for the staging of conferences and other events and upgraded changerooms are some of the major elements of the Albury project
Stage one works have been estimated to cost more than $4 million.
